Final Arrangements for the Smile Club Ni Multi Activity Summer Scheme at R.B.A.I. 2023

Scheme to be held from the 17th of July 2023. Information applies to children attending Week 1, Week 2 or Both Weeks.

I am sure all the children are very excited, as we are, for our Summer Scheme to
get under way!

Hopefully the weather will be great! As we have outstanding facilities all
around the school, we can offer additional different indoor activities if
required.

Children will be given FREE T-SHIRTS on the first day. Whatever the week booked.

Drop off and pick up arrangements

Front of School on College Square East, Parents can come right through the gates to the front of school.

Early drop off time are from 8.30 a.m.

The summer scheme activities will start at 9.30

Early pick up when activities finish is at 3.15 p.m.

Late pick up is at 5.00 p.m.

You will be greeted by members of the team on arrival, and the entrance is
manned by a member of the R.B.A.I. ground staff. The hub of the scheme is
located in the 6th form centre.

CHILDREN WILL NOT BE PERMITTED TO LEAVE THE SCHOOL SITE

Lunch arrangements

Children are to bring their own packed lunch. There will be a small tuck shop
available if any child wishes to purchase soft drinks and snacks. Please do not send children to the scheme with foods containing nuts.

Consent Form

A consent form must be completed and handed in on arrival
on the first morning. I will have some spares so don’t panic if you leave the
house without it. This can be found on the footer section of the website or click on link below.

Consent Form

Swimming

Please bring swimming kit each day. Although there will not be swimming every
day, we have the option of using our fantastic 25m swimming pool and holding
additional swim classes if the weather is poor outside.

Clothing and footwear

We will not be outside in any rainy or cold conditions, therefore suitable
clothing should be brought for many of the sporting activities. Trainers should
be brought. If it does happen to be very hot, please advice the child to bring
their own sun cream.
